 Tullimbar’s Yellow Rock Road upgrade officially underway

Construction has officially kicked off on the Yellow Rock Road upgrade in Tullimbar, with Shellharbour City Council breaking ground on the project this week.


A ceremony was held on Friday to mark the move from the planning phase into actual construction.


In attendance were Shellharbour City Mayor Chris Homer, Member for Whitlam Carol Berry, and representatives from Cleary Bros, the local firm appointed to carry out the works.



The project focuses on the stretch of Yellow Rock Road between the Illawarra Highway and Araluen Terrace.


The goal is to improve safety and connectivity for the growing local community as more families move into the area.


Mayor Chris Homer thanked the Australian Government for its financial contribution through the Safer Local Roads and Infrastructure Program and the Road to Recovery program.


“I want to thank the Australian Government for its strong support of this upgrade,” he said.



“This partnership will help us deliver safer, more accessible connections for the growing Tullimbar community.”


The upgrade includes:


  • New road pavement and upgraded intersections at Wongawilli Street and Hereford Chase.
  • Improved pedestrian paths and crossings to make walking safer.
  • New kerbs, gutters, and stormwater drainage to prevent flooding.
  • Better on-street parking and overall accessibility.



Council recently held drop-in sessions with the contractors to walk residents through the construction timelines and access arrangements.


Work will continue over the coming months, and residents can keep track of the progress via the Council’s "Let’s Chat" website.
